Understanding Anxiety and Depression: Resources for Support and Healing
Anxiety and depression are common mental health conditions that can significantly influence a person's life. These disorders often present as persistent feelings of worry, sadness, hopelessness, and tiredness. Seeking help is crucial for managing these conditions and recovering. Fortunately, there are numerous resources available to those in need struggling with anxiety and depression.
- Therapy: A licensed therapist can provide helpful treatment options such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) or interpersonal therapy.
- Support groups: Connecting with others who understand what you're going through can be incredibly valuable.
- Medication: In some cases, a doctor may suggest medication to help manage symptoms.
- Healthy habits: Engaging in regular exercise, eating a balanced diet, and getting enough sleep can positively impact mental health.
Remember that you're not alone, and there is hope available. Reaching out for help is a sign of strength, and taking steps toward healing can lead to a more fulfilling life.
